Selecting pitch by price only, ignoring content type, and skipping site risk checks are the top pre-install mistakes. These issues usually appear later as readability complaints or unstable operations.
A small planning shortcut often creates large downstream cost.
Rushed wiring, poor grounding discipline, and incomplete mapping validation can create intermittent faults that are hard to diagnose. Commissioning should not be compressed to meet arbitrary deadlines.
Quality acceptance must include real content testing, not only pattern testing.
Even well-installed screens degrade when teams lack SOP. Untrained operators, unmanaged content pipeline, and delayed maintenance quickly reduce confidence.
Assign clear ownership for daily checks and escalation path.

Bangladesh projects need local context planning: high humidity, dust exposure, power fluctuation, monsoon rain, and heavy runtime during campaign periods.
We design maintenance and backup strategy early so the screen remains stable after launch.
Long-term uptime depends on stack quality, not only display module quality. Controller, receiving card, PSU, and signal chain must be matched as one system.
